About the Artist Ilnur Siraziyev

Born in 1970, Ilnur Siraziyev is a celebrated painter and graphic artist from Tatarstan. He studied at the Kazan Art School and later refined his skills at esteemed institutions. He earned the title of Honored Artist of the Republic of Tatarstan and has received awards such as the Fine Arts Prize named after Haris Yakupov. His dedication to cultural roots shines through his work. “Aunt Ramziya and a cat” is a vibrant example of his ability to capture the soul of Tatar traditions while speaking in a universal artistic language.
